def main(): values = list(input()) #print(values) count = 0 while not check(values): sorted_values = sort_values(values) count += 1 print(count) def check(values): if sorted(values) == values: return True else: return False def sort_values(values): last_B_pos = -1 for i, v in enumerate(values): if v == 'A': if last_B_pos >= 0: if last_B_pos + 1 == i: values[last_B_pos] = 'A' values[i] = 'B' return values else: last_B_pos = i if __name__ == '__main__': main()